Technical Field
The utility model relates to the technical field of fruit and vegetable beating, in particular to a fruit and vegetable beating device.
Background
Fruits and vegetables are short for fruits and vegetables. The fruit and vegetable pulping machine is a machine for pulping and refining fruits and vegetables by utilizing a motor to drive knife teeth, is a type of food relative to meat, and sometimes needs to be used as a pulping machine in the processing process of fruits and vegetables, and the requirement on the pulping machine is further increased along with the increasing living standard of people.
There are many defects in the traditional beating machine, the current beating machine adopts conventional spiral motion to perform beating, only adopts a single beating blade to complete beating, has poor beating effect, for example, the fruit and vegetable juice pulp yield after beating is not high, and the beaten pulp is not fine enough, so that an improved beating machine is needed to meet the demands.
Disclosure of Invention
Therefore, the utility model provides a fruit and vegetable pulping device to solve the problems of poor pulping effect and low pulp yield.

Referring to fig. 1-4, the fruit and vegetable beating device provided by the utility model comprises a first machine body 1 and a second machine body 2, wherein two sides of the second machine body 2 are fixedly provided with a fixed block 3, the bottom of the fixed block 3 is provided with a support frame 4, the top of the first machine body 1 is fixedly provided with a feeding pipe 5, the bottom of the second machine body 2 is provided with a discharge hole 6, one side of the feeding pipe 5 is provided with a motor 7, an output shaft of the motor 7 is fixedly connected with a transmission shaft 8, the outside of the transmission shaft 8 is fixedly sleeved with a blade 9, the bottom of the first machine body 1 is provided with a hole 10, the bottom of the transmission shaft 8 extends to the inside of the second machine body 2 and is fixedly connected with a shell 11, two gears one 12 are arranged in the inside of the shell 11, two sides of the gears one 12 are respectively connected with a gear two 13 in a meshed manner, one side of the gear two gears 13 far away from the gear one side of the gear one 12 is fixedly provided with a shaft lever, one side of the shaft lever far away from the gear two 13 is fixedly provided with a stirring blade 14, and one end of the bottom of the transmission shaft 8 extending to the outside of the bottom of the shell 11 is fixedly sleeved with a spiral blade 15;
in this embodiment, throw in the inside of fuselage one 1 from inlet pipe 5, motor 7 output shaft can drive transmission shaft 8 and rotate, when transmission shaft 8 rotates, can drive blade 9, stirring piece 16 and spiral leaf 15 rotate, blade 9 can break fruit vegetables, the fruit thick liquid that produces can flow out from the hole 10 of fuselage one 1 bottom when breaking, stirring piece 16 can handle fuselage one 1 bottom, prevent that unbroken fruit vegetables from blockking up hole 10, when fruit thick liquid flows to the inside of fuselage two 2, pile up in the bottom, spiral leaf 15 can constantly stir the fruit thick liquid of pile up, and turn over the fruit thick liquid of bottom to the top, transmission shaft 8 can drive gear one 12 and rotate simultaneously, gear one 12 can drive gear two 13 and rotate when rotating, make the axostylus axostyle drive stirring leaf 14 rotate, fruit thick liquid that the spiral leaf 15 spiral brought up carries out abundant stirring, fruit thick liquid beating rate has been accelerated, when accomplishing the beating, open discharge gate 6, collect fruit thick liquid, can accomplish work.
In order to achieve the purposes of convenience and stability, the device is achieved by adopting the following technical scheme: the bottom end of the first machine body 1 is fixedly connected with the top end of the second machine body 2, so that the first machine body 1 and the second machine body 2 are prevented from being rocked when the motor 7 is started;
in order to achieve the purpose of convenient transmission, the device is realized by adopting the following technical scheme: the transmission shaft 8 penetrates through the first machine body 1, the machine shell 11 and the second machine body 2 and extends into the second machine body 2, and can simultaneously provide power for the blade 9, the stirring block 16, the spiral blade 15 and the stirring blade 14;
wherein, in order to realize the purpose of convenient stirring, this device adopts following technical scheme to realize: the shaft rod penetrates through the shell 11 and extends into the second shell 11, the shaft rod is movably connected with the shell 11 through a bearing, the shaft rod can drive the stirring blade 14 to rotate, and the effect of the bearing on the shell 11 is avoided;
in order to achieve the aim of convenient connection, the device is achieved by adopting the following technical scheme: the output shaft of the motor 7 is movably connected with the first machine body 1 through a bearing, when the output shaft of the motor 7 rotates, the transmission shaft 8 is driven to rotate, and the first machine body 1 cannot be influenced under the action of the bearing;
in order to achieve the aim of facilitating rotation, the device is achieved by adopting the following technical scheme: the joint of the transmission shaft 8 and the first machine body 1 and the second machine body 2 is movably connected through a bearing;
in order to achieve the purpose of conveniently accelerating the speed, the device is achieved by adopting the following technical scheme: the inner wall of the second machine body 2 is provided with a convex object, so that the stirring speed can be increased during stirring;
wherein, in order to realize the purpose of making things convenient for the ejection of compact, this device adopts following technical scheme to realize: the bottom of the interior of the machine body II 2 is arc-shaped, and when the work is completed, fruit pulp cannot remain in the interior of the machine body II 2;
wherein, in order to realize the purpose of convenient breakage, this device adopts following technical scheme to realize: blade 9 is located the inside of fuselage one 1, the inside of fuselage one 1 is equipped with stirring piece 16, stirring piece 16 fixed connection is in the outside of transmission shaft 8, and blade 9 can break fruit vegetables, and the fruit thick liquid that produces can flow out from the hole 10 of fuselage one 1 bottom when breaking, and stirring piece 16 can handle fuselage one 1 bottom, prevents uncrushed fruit vegetables jam hole 10.
The application process of the utility model is as follows: when the fruit and vegetable stirring machine is used, fruits and vegetables are thrown into the machine body 1 from the feed pipe 5, the motor 7 is started, the output shaft of the motor 7 drives the transmission shaft 8 to rotate, the blade 9, the stirring block 16 and the spiral blade 15 are driven to rotate when the transmission shaft 8 rotates, the blade 9 can crush the fruits and vegetables, the fruit pulp generated during crushing flows out of the hole 10 at the bottom of the machine body 1, the stirring block 16 can treat the bottom of the machine body 1 to prevent the unbroken fruits and vegetables from blocking the hole 10, when the fruit pulp flows into the machine body 2, the spiral blade 15 can continuously stir the accumulated fruit pulp when accumulating at the bottom, and the fruit pulp at the bottom is turned over to the upper side, meanwhile, the transmission shaft 8 drives the gear one 12 to rotate, the gear one 12 drives the gear two 13 to rotate when rotating, so that the shaft rod drives the stirring blade 14 to rotate, the fruit pulp brought by the spiral blade 15 is fully stirred, the fruit pulp beating speed is accelerated, and when beating is finished, the discharge port 6 is opened, the fruit pulp is collected, and the work can be completed.
